Lesson Plan C#
Lesson Plan C#
Lesson Plan C#
TEXT BOOKS:
1. E. Balagurusamy, "Programming in C#: A Primer", 3rd ed,Tata McGraw-Hill, 2010. (Unit I, II)
2. J. Liberty, "Programming C#", 2nd ed., O'Reilly, 2002. (Unit III, IV, V)
3. Yashavant Kanetkar, C#.Net Fundas", BPB Publications, 2003. (Fast Track Course)
REFERECE BOOKS:
1. Herbert Schildt, "The Complete Reference: C#", Tata McGraw-Hill, 2004.
2. Deitel et al, "Visual C# 2005 How to Program", 2nd ed., Pearson Education, 2007.(Unit III,IV)
3.B.Rama Krishana Rao,Programming with C# concepts and Practice, PHI, 2007.(Unit III)
4. Kogent solutions inc, "C# Projects: Covers C# 2005 and C# 2008", DreamTech Press, 2008.
V.JANANI HOD
ADHIYAMAAN COLLEGE OF ENGINEERING
Page : 2 of 3
Dr. M.G.R. Nagar - Hosur - 635 109.
Department of Electronics and Communication Engineering
Class
Sl.No Period / TOPIC Remarks
Hour
Week : 06 UNIT III DATA STRUCTURES
1 Algorithm Design Techniques
2 Greedy Algorithm
3 Divide and Conquer
4 Dynamic Programming, Backtracking Algorithms
Week : 07
1 Lists, stacks, Queues
2 Array Implementation of Stack and Queue
3 List Implementation of Stack and Queue
4 Priority Queues
Week : 08
1 Binary Heap
2 Applications of Priority Queues
3 Binomial Queues
4 Revision
Week : 09 UNIT IV NONLINEAR DATA STRUCTURES
1 Trees
2 Binary trees, Binary Search Tree
3 AVL Trees
4 Splay Trees
Week : 10
1 Top-Down Splay Trees
2 Red-Black Trees.
3 Shortest path algorithm, network flow problems
4 Minimum spanning tree
Page No : 3 of 3
ADHIYAMAAN COLLEGE OF ENGINEERING
Dr. M.G.R. Nagar - Hosur - 635 109.
Department of Electronics and Communication Engineering
Class
Sl.No Period / TOPIC Remarks
Hour
Week : 11
1 Applications of DFS
2 Introduction to NP Completeness
3 Revision
4 Revision
Week : 12 UNIT - V SORTING AND SEARCHING
1 Sorting
2 Insertion sort
3 Shell sort
4 Heap sort
Week : 13
1 Merge sort
2 Quick sort
3 Bucket sort
4 External Sorting
Week : 14
1 Linear Search
2 Binary Search
3 Sequential Search
4 Interpolation Search
Week : 15
1 Revision
2 Revision
3 Revision
4 Revision
TEXT BOOKS:
1. Mark Allen Weiss, Data Structures and Algorithm Analysis in C, 3 rd ed, Pearson Education Asia, 2007.
2. E. Balagurusamy, Object Oriented Programming with C++, McGraw Hill Company Ltd., 2007.
REFERENCES:
1. Michael T. Goodrich, Data Structures and Algorithm Analysis in C++, Wiley student
Edition, 2007.
2. Sahni, Data Structures Using C++, The McGraw-Hill, 2006.
3. Seymour, Data Structures, The McGraw-Hill, 2007.
4. Jean Paul Tremblay & Paul G.Sorenson, An Introduction to data structures with
applications, Tata McGraw Hill edition, II Edition, 2002.
5. John R.Hubbard, Schaums outline of theory and problem of data structure with C++,
McGraw-Hill, New Delhi, 2000.
Prepared by : Approved by :
Date :
Page No : 3 of 3
ADHIYAMAAN COLLEGE OF ENGINEERING
Malini.A.P Dr. M.G.R. Nagar - Hosur
HOD - 635 109.
Department of Electronics and Communication Engineering
ADHIYAMAAN COLLEGE OF ENGINEERING (AUTONOMOUS) - HOSUR
DEPARTMENT OF ELECTRONICS AND COMMUNICATION ENGINEERING
MALINI.A.P HOD